Software Engineer, Product

Meta builds technologies that help people connect, find communities, and grow businesses through social platforms and immersive experiences.
$137,000 - $158,400
Backend
Entry-Level Software Engineer
In-Person
AR/VR · Social Media

Description For Software Engineer, Product

Meta, formerly Facebook Inc., is at the forefront of social technology innovation, transforming how billions of people connect worldwide through platforms like Facebook, Instagram, WhatsApp, and Messenger. As a Software Engineer in the Product team, you'll be part of a company that's pushing boundaries beyond traditional social media into immersive technologies like AR and VR.

The role offers an exciting opportunity to work on large-scale systems that impact billions of users globally. You'll be developing and designing software applications while maintaining high standards for code quality and test coverage. The position requires strong technical skills in various programming languages and frameworks, with opportunities to work on both infrastructure and product development.

This is an ideal position for someone starting their career in software engineering, offering exposure to cutting-edge technology and the chance to work with some of the industry's best engineers. The compensation package is competitive, including a base salary range of $137,000-$158,400, plus bonus and equity opportunities.

Meta's commitment to innovation extends to its workplace culture, offering comprehensive benefits and a supportive environment that encourages professional growth. You'll be part of a team that's shaping the future of digital connection, working on projects that go beyond traditional social media into the next evolution of social technology.

The company's mission to help people connect and build communities remains at the core of everything they do, and as a Software Engineer, you'll play a crucial role in bringing this vision to life through technical innovation and creative problem-solving.

Last updated 2 days ago

Responsibilities For Software Engineer, Product

  • Develop, design, create, modify, and/or test software applications or systems for various products or software services
  • Develop a strong understanding of relevant product area, codebase, and/or systems
  • Demonstrate proficiency in data analysis, programming, and software engineering
  • Produce high-quality code with good test coverage using modern abstractions and frameworks
  • Work on problems of moderate scope where analysis of situations or data requires a review of various factors
  • Exercise judgment within defined procedures and practices to determine appropriate action
  • Master internal development standards from developing to releasing code

Requirements For Software Engineer, Product

Java
Python
PHP
JavaScript
  • Bachelor's degree in Computer Science, Engineering, Information Systems, Analytics, Mathematics, Physics, Applied Sciences, or related field
  • Experience with coding in C, C++, Java, or C#
  • Experience building large-scale infrastructure applications
  • Experience creating web applications using Python, PHP, or Ruby
  • Experience with relational databases
  • Experience with SQL
  • Experience implementing web interfaces using JavaScript, HTML, or CSS

Benefits For Software Engineer, Product

Medical Insurance
Equity
  • Bonus
  • Equity
  • Benefits package available

Interested in this job?

Jobs Related To Meta Software Engineer, Product

Software Engineer

Entry-level Software Engineer position at Meta, focusing on developing and maintaining various software applications and systems.

Software Engineer

Software Engineering role at Meta focusing on developing and maintaining large-scale social technology platforms and next-generation AR/VR experiences.

Software Engineer, Product

Entry-level Software Engineer position at Meta, focusing on product development with competitive salary and benefits in New York City.

Software Engineer, Product

Entry-level Software Engineer position at Meta focusing on developing and maintaining large-scale distributed systems and product features.

Software Engineer

Entry-level Software Engineer position at Meta focusing on backend development and systems-level software for social technology platforms.